Healthcare and Covid compensation are a clash. Private clinics are fighting back: a formal notice has been sent to the Region.

A formal notice from AIOP , the Italian Association of Private Hospitals, which groups accredited healthcare facilities, was sent to the Region yesterday morning. The formal notice concerns the intention, announced and reiterated by President Michele de Pascale, to revoke the council resolution dated November 11, 2024, regarding financial compensation paid by affiliated clinics during the pandemic .
The Region, then led by Stefano Bonaccini, during the height of the Covid emergency (spring 2020), asked private facilities to remain fully operational to address a situation whose evolution was still completely unknown. Therefore, clinic healthcare workers were not placed on furlough, as they needed to be available at all times, and over 5,000 beds were made available to the public healthcare system, through an agreement between AIOP and Viale Aldo Moro.
For this commitment, accredited facilities in Emilia-Romagna received approximately €80 million. The Region now demands this back, given the express desire to revoke the resolution, which was reiterated during last Thursday's meeting attended by President de Pascale, Health Councilor Massimo Fabi, Regional Director General of Health Lorenzo Broccoli, and Regional President of AIOP Cesare Salvi, along with the two vice presidents, Averardo Orta and Valentina Valentini.
Given the Region's currently irrevocable situation, AIOP has sent a formal formal notice to President De Pascale and, for the relevant jurisdiction, Councilor Fabi and Director Broccoli.
The document calls on the Region to desist from revoking the resolution or, at least, to reevaluate the situation, not only in compliance with regulatory constraints, but also in light of the decades-long relationship of collaboration between accredited private facilities and the Emilia-Romagna public healthcare system. Naturally, the Region is also warned against implementing conditions for requesting the refund of the advance payments (€80 million) received in the first year of the pandemic, i.e., 2020, given that costs and investments have already been incurred.
In this regard, it is explicitly stated that the Association reserves the right to protect the rights of its members (over 50 organizations) in all appropriate venues, including, of course, administrative and ordinary courts.
